Motor Tuning Improvements

Engine tuning adjustments play an essential role in maximizing a vehicle's speed and output. By fine-tuning engine parameters, such as fuel-air ratio and ignition timing, these tweaks can greatly improve horsepower and torque. Performance chips and engine management systems allow for precise adjustments, enabling drivers to tap into their vehicle's full potential. Upgrading to high-performance exhaust systems improves airflow, reducing back pressure and increasing engine efficiency. Additionally, aftermarket intakes boost the amount of air entering the engine, promoting better combustion. Together, these enhancements lead to quicker acceleration and improved throttle response. Suspension Enhancements for Better Maneuverability

Suspension enhancements serve as a fundamental element in enhancing a vehicle's maneuverability, as they directly influence how the car relates to the road. These modifications enhance steadiness, sensitivity, and comfort characteristics. By changing factory components with high-grade suspension parts, drivers can achieve enhanced cornering ability, decreased body sway, and heightened traction.

Enhanced sway bars boost lateral stiffness, permitting enhanced handling when turning. Coilover systems deliver adjustable ride height and dampening control, letting drivers to adjust their vehicle's stance and handling characteristics. Furthermore, performance bushings are able to reduce deflection and strengthen road feedback, fostering a more tactile and communicative driving sensation.

Boost Power With High-Performance Exhaust Systems

Improving a auto’s handling via upgraded suspension components sets up the possibility for greater performance improvements, notably through installing performance exhaust systems. These exhaust setups are vital in maximizing engine output by letting exhaust gases flow out more easily. The reduction in pressure not only raises engine horsepower but also boosts torque delivery, which leads to a quicker driving experience.

Moreover, premium-grade exhaust systems can be constructed from reduced-weight materials, further lending to general vehicle operation. Many systems are designed to produce a more intense sound, appealing to enthusiasts seeking an auditory experience that matches their vehicle's aesthetics. In addition, these systems can often boost fuel efficiency by maximizing exhaust flow.

Compatible With Auto

Grasping vehicle compatibility is fundamental in the pursuit for performance upgrades. Every vehicle features specific design parameters, such as engine type, suspension layout, and electronic systems, which dictate the suitability of aftermarket parts. Drivers need to evaluate aspects like make, model, and year to verify that parts fit properly and perform optimally. Furthermore, compatibility between performance parts and existing systems is necessary; for instance, an upgraded exhaust system must comply with the vehicle's emissions standards. Neglecting these factors can result in poor performance or even cause damage. Do Performance Parts Come With Warranties?

Yes, many performance parts come with warranties that vary by manufacturer. These guarantees often include protection for defects in materials or workmanship, but may not include damage from incorrect installation or misuse, so it's crucial to review conditions thoroughly.

Can Performance Enhancements Invalidate My Vehicle's Warranty?

Performance improvements can nullify a vehicle's warranty, notably if the manufacturer finds that the modifications caused the damage. Drivers should consult their warranty documentation to grasp potential implications before making upgrades.
